如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

Java 14 下载指南:全面了解与应用

Java 14 下载指南:全面了解与应用

Java 14作为Java语言的一个重要版本,带来了许多新特性和改进,吸引了众多开发者的关注。本文将为大家详细介绍Java 14 download的相关信息,包括下载方式、安装步骤、以及一些常见的应用场景。

Java 14 的新特性

Java 14 引入了一些令人兴奋的新特性:

  1. 记录(Records):这是一个简化数据载体类的语法糖,减少了样板代码的编写。

  2. Switch 表达式:增强了switch语句,使其可以作为表达式使用,语法更加简洁。

  3. 文本块(Text Blocks):允许开发者在代码中直接编写多行字符串,极大地方便了字符串的处理。

  4. NullPointerExceptions 增强:提供更详细的异常信息,帮助开发者更快地定位问题。

  5. 移除 CMS 垃圾回收器:官方不再支持Concurrent Mark Sweep (CMS)垃圾回收器,推荐使用G1或ZGC。

Java 14 Download

要下载Java 14,你可以访问Oracle的官方网站或其他可靠的下载源:

  • Oracle JDK 14:访问Oracle的Java下载页面,选择Java SE 14,然后根据你的操作系统选择相应的版本(Windows、Linux、macOS等)。

  • OpenJDK 14:如果你更倾向于开源版本,可以从AdoptOpenJDK或其他提供OpenJDK的网站下载。

下载完成后,根据你的操作系统进行安装:

  • Windows:双击安装程序,按照提示完成安装。

  • Linux:解压缩下载的tar.gz文件,然后设置环境变量。

  • macOS:可以使用Homebrew或直接下载安装包。

安装后的配置

安装完成后,需要配置环境变量:

export JAVA_HOME=/path/to/java14
export PATH=$JAVA_HOME/bin:$PATH

确保你的系统能够识别到Java 14的路径。

Java 14 的应用场景

Java 14的应用非常广泛:

  1. 企业级应用:Java一直是企业级应用开发的首选语言,Java 14的改进使得开发更加高效。

  2. Web开发:Spring Boot等框架可以利用Java 14的新特性进行优化。

  3. Android开发:虽然Android开发主要使用Java 8,但Java 14的一些特性可以通过插件或库间接使用。

  4. 大数据处理:Hadoop、Spark等大数据框架可以从Java 14的性能提升中受益。

  5. 微服务架构:Java 14的轻量级特性使得微服务的开发和部署更加灵活。

注意事项

  • 兼容性:确保你的项目或库与Java 14兼容,避免因版本差异导致的运行问题。

  • 学习曲线:虽然Java 14带来了许多新特性,但也需要开发者花时间学习和适应。

  • 生产环境:在将Java 14应用于生产环境之前,建议进行充分的测试。

总结

Java 14的发布为Java开发者带来了许多新的可能性。通过Java 14 download,你可以体验到这些新特性带来的便利和效率提升。无论你是企业开发者、Web开发者还是大数据工程师,Java 14都值得一试。记得在下载和使用过程中遵守相关法律法规,确保软件的合法使用和安全性。希望本文对你有所帮助,祝你在Java开发的道路上不断进步!